LG61 FHE is a 2011 Chevrolet Aveo in Silver with a 1,206c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 54.5%.

Across all 2011 Chevrolet Aveo models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.5% with a typical mileage of 45,773 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Chevrolet Aveo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 4,014 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LG61 FHE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Chevrolet Aveo typ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 15 years old, this Chevrolet Aveo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
